/* Configure script for libxslt, specific for Windows with Scripting Host.
*
* This script will configure the libxslt build process and create necessary files.
* Run it with an 'help', or an invalid option and it will tell you what options
* it accepts.
*
* March 2002, Igor Zlatkovic <igor@zlatkovic.com>
*/
/* The source directory, relative to the one where this file resides. */
var baseDir = "..";
var srcDirXslt = baseDir + "\\libxslt";
var srcDirExslt = baseDir + "\\libexslt";
var srcDirUtils = baseDir + "\\xsltproc";
/* The directory where we put the binaries after compilation. */
var binDir = "binaries";
/* Base name of what we are building. */
var baseNameXslt = "libxslt";
var baseNameExslt = "libexslt";
/* Configure file which contains the version and the output file where
we can store our build configuration. */
var configFile = baseDir + "\\configure.ac";
var versionFile = ".\\config.msvc";
/* Input and output files regarding the lib(e)xml features. The second
output file is there for the compatibility reasons, otherwise it
is identical to the first. */
var optsFileInXslt = srcDirXslt + "\\xsltconfig.h.in";
var optsFileXslt = srcDirXslt + "\\xsltconfig.h";
var optsFileInExslt = srcDirExslt + "\\exsltconfig.h.in";
var optsFileExslt = srcDirExslt + "\\exsltconfig.h";
/* Version strings for the binary distribution. Will be filled later
in the code. */
var verMajorXslt;
var verMinorXslt;
var verMicroXslt;
var verMajorExslt;
var verMinorExslt;
var verMicroExslt;
var verLibxmlReq;
var verCvs;
var useCvsVer = true;
/* Libxslt features. */
var withTrio = false;
var withXsltDebug = true;
var withMemDebug = false;
var withDebugger = true;
var withIconv = true;
var withZlib = false;
var withCrypto = true;
var withModules = false;
var withProfiler = true;
var withPython = false;
/* Win32 build options. */
var dirSep = "\\";
var compiler = "msvc";
var cruntime = "/MD";
var vcmanifest = false;
var buildDebug = 0;
var buildStatic = 0;
var buildPrefix = ".";
var buildBinPrefix = "";
var buildIncPrefix = "";
var buildLibPrefix = "";
var buildSoPrefix = "";
var buildInclude = ".";
var buildLib = ".";
/* Local stuff */
var error = 0;
/* Helper function, transforms the option variable into the 'Enabled'
or 'Disabled' string. */
function boolToStr(opt)
{
if (opt == false)
return "no";
else if (opt == true)
return "yes";
error = 1;
return "*** undefined ***";
}
/* Helper function, transforms the argument string into the boolean
value. */
function strToBool(opt)
{
if (opt == "0" || opt == "no")
return false;
else if (opt == "1" || opt == "yes")
return true;
error = 1;
return false;
}
/* Displays the details about how to use this script. */
function usage()
{
var txt;
txt = "Usage:\n";
txt += " cscript " + WScript.ScriptName + " <options>\n";
txt += " cscript " + WScript.ScriptName + " help\n\n";
txt += "Options can be specified in the form <option>=<value>, where the value is\n";
txt += "either 'yes' or 'no'.\n\n";
txt += "XSLT processor options, default value given in parentheses:\n\n";
txt += " trio: Enable TRIO string manipulator (" + (withTrio? "yes" : "no") + ")\n";
txt += " xslt_debug: Enable XSLT debbugging module (" + (withXsltDebug? "yes" : "no") + ")\n";
txt += " mem_debug: Enable memory debugger (" + (withMemDebug? "yes" : "no") + ")\n";
txt += " debugger: Enable external debugger support (" + (withDebugger? "yes" : "no") + ")\n";
txt += " iconv: Use iconv library (" + (withIconv? "yes" : "no") + ")\n";
txt += " zlib: Use zlib library (" + (withZlib? "yes" : "no") + ")\n";
txt += " crypto: Enable Crypto support (" + (withCrypto? "yes" : "no") + ")\n";
txt += " modules: Enable Module support (" + (withModules? "yes" : "no") + ")\n";
txt += " profiler: Enable Profiler support (" + (withProfiler? "yes" : "no") + ")\n";
txt += " python: Build Python bindings (" + (withPython? "yes" : "no") + ")\n";
txt += "\nWin32 build options, default value given in parentheses:\n\n";
txt += " compiler: Compiler to be used [msvc|mingw] (" + compiler + ")\n";
txt += " cruntime: C-runtime compiler option (only msvc) (" + cruntime + ")\n";
txt += " vcmanifest: Embed VC manifest (only msvc) (" + (vcmanifest? "yes" : "no") + ")\n";
txt += " debug: Build unoptimised debug executables (" + (buildDebug? "yes" : "no") + ")\n";
txt += " static: Link xsltproc statically to libxslt (" + (buildStatic? "yes" : "no") + ")\n";
txt += " Note: automatically enabled if cruntime is not /MD or /MDd\n";
txt += " prefix: Base directory for the installation (" + buildPrefix + ")\n";
txt += " bindir: Directory where xsltproc and friends should be installed\n";
txt += " (" + buildBinPrefix + ")\n";
txt += " incdir: Directory where headers should be installed\n";
txt += " (" + buildIncPrefix + ")\n";
txt += " libdir: Directory where static and import libraries should be\n";
txt += " installed (" + buildLibPrefix + ")\n";
txt += " sodir: Directory where shared libraries should be installed\n";
txt += " (" + buildSoPrefix + ")\n";
txt += " include: Additional search path for the compiler, particularily\n";
txt += " where libxml headers can be found (" + buildInclude + ")\n";
txt += " lib: Additional search path for the linker, particularily\n";
txt += " where libxml library can be found (" + buildLib + ")\n";
WScript.Echo(txt);
}
/* Discovers the version we are working with by reading the apropriate
configuration file. Despite its name, this also writes the configuration
file included by our makefile. */
function discoverVersion()
{
var fso, cf, vf, ln, s, m;
fso = new ActiveXObject("Scripting.FileSystemObject");
verCvs = "";
cf = fso.OpenTextFile(configFile, 1);
if (compiler == "msvc")
versionFile = ".\\config.msvc";
else if (compiler == "mingw")
versionFile = ".\\config.mingw";
vf = fso.CreateTextFile(versionFile, true);
vf.WriteLine("# " + versionFile);
vf.WriteLine("# This file is generated automatically by " + WScript.ScriptName + ".");
vf.WriteBlankLines(1);
while (cf.AtEndOfStream != true) {
ln = cf.ReadLine();
s = new String(ln);
if (m = s.match(/^m4_define\(\[MAJOR_VERSION\], \[(.*)\]\)/)) {
vf.WriteLine("LIBXSLT_MAJOR_VERSION=" + m[1]);
verMajorXslt = m[1];
} else if(m = s.match(/^m4_define\(\[MINOR_VERSION\], \[(.*)\]\)/)) {
vf.WriteLine("LIBXSLT_MINOR_VERSION=" + m[1]);
verMinorXslt = m[1];
} else if(m = s.match(/^m4_define\(\[MICRO_VERSION\], \[(.*)\]\)/)) {
vf.WriteLine("LIBXSLT_MICRO_VERSION=" + m[1]);
verMicroXslt = m[1];
} else if (s.search(/^LIBEXSLT_MAJOR_VERSION=/) != -1) {
vf.WriteLine(s);
verMajorExslt = s.substring(s.indexOf("=") + 1, s.length);
} else if(s.search(/^LIBEXSLT_MINOR_VERSION=/) != -1) {
vf.WriteLine(s);
verMinorExslt = s.substring(s.indexOf("=") + 1, s.length);
} else if(s.search(/^LIBEXSLT_MICRO_VERSION=/) != -1) {
vf.WriteLine(s);
verMicroExslt = s.substring(s.indexOf("=") + 1, s.length);
} else if(s.search(/^LIBXML_REQUIRED_VERSION=/) != -1) {
vf.WriteLine(s);
verLibxmlReq = s.substring(s.indexOf("=") + 1, s.length);
}
}
cf.Close();
vf.WriteLine("WITH_TRIO=" + (withTrio? "1" : "0"));
vf.WriteLine("WITH_DEBUG=" + (withXsltDebug? "1" : "0"));
vf.WriteLine("WITH_DEBUGGER=" + (withDebugger? "1" : "0"));
vf.WriteLine("WITH_ICONV=" + (withIconv? "1" : "0"));
vf.WriteLine("WITH_ZLIB=" + (withZlib? "1" : "0"));
vf.WriteLine("WITH_CRYPTO=" + (withCrypto? "1" : "0"));
vf.WriteLine("WITH_MODULES=" + (withModules? "1" : "0"));
vf.WriteLine("WITH_PROFILER=" + (withProfiler? "1" : "0"));
vf.WriteLine("WITH_PYTHON=" + (withPython? "1" : "0"));
vf.WriteLine("DEBUG=" + (buildDebug? "1" : "0"));
vf.WriteLine("STATIC=" + (buildStatic? "1" : "0"));
vf.WriteLine("PREFIX=" + buildPrefix);
vf.WriteLine("BINPREFIX=" + buildBinPrefix);
vf.WriteLine("INCPREFIX=" + buildIncPrefix);
vf.WriteLine("LIBPREFIX=" + buildLibPrefix);
vf.WriteLine("SOPREFIX=" + buildSoPrefix);
if (compiler == "msvc") {
vf.WriteLine("INCLUDE=$(INCLUDE);" + buildInclude);
vf.WriteLine("LIB=$(LIB);" + buildLib);
vf.WriteLine("CRUNTIME=" + cruntime);
vf.WriteLine("VCMANIFEST=" + (vcmanifest? "1" : "0"));
} else if (compiler == "mingw") {
vf.WriteLine("INCLUDE+=;" + buildInclude);
vf.WriteLine("LIB+=;" + buildLib);
}
vf.Close();
}
/* Configures libxslt. This one will generate xsltconfig.h from xsltconfig.h.in
taking what the user passed on the command line into account. */
function configureXslt()
{
var fso, ofi, of, ln, s;
fso = new ActiveXObject("Scripting.FileSystemObject");
ofi = fso.OpenTextFile(optsFileInXslt, 1);
of = fso.CreateTextFile(optsFileXslt, true);
while (ofi.AtEndOfStream != true) {
ln = ofi.ReadLine();
s = new String(ln);
if (s.search(/\@VERSION\@/) != -1) {
of.WriteLine(s.replace(/\@VERSION\@/,
verMajorXslt + "." + verMinorXslt + "." + verMicroXslt));
} else if (s.search(/\@LIBXSLT_VERSION_NUMBER\@/) != -1) {
of.WriteLine(s.replace(/\@LIBXSLT_VERSION_NUMBER\@/,
verMajorXslt*10000 + verMinorXslt*100 + verMicroXslt*1));
} else if (s.search(/\@LIBXSLT_VERSION_EXTRA\@/) != -1) {
of.WriteLine(s.replace(/\@LIBXSLT_VERSION_EXTRA\@/, verCvs));
} else if (s.search(/\@WITH_TRIO\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_TRIO\@/, withTrio? "1" : "0"));
} else if (s.search(/\@WITH_XSLT_DEBUG\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_XSLT_DEBUG\@/, withXsltDebug? "1" : "0"));
} else if (s.search(/\@WITH_DEBUGGER\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_DEBUGGER\@/, withDebugger? "1" : "0"));
} else if (s.search(/\@WITH_MODULES\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_MODULES\@/, withModules? "1" : "0"));
} else if (s.search(/\@WITH_PROFILER\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_PROFILER\@/, withProfiler? "1" : "0"));
} else if (s.search(/\@LIBXSLT_DEFAULT_PLUGINS_PATH\@/) != -1) {
of.WriteLine(s.replace(/\@LIBXSLT_DEFAULT_PLUGINS_PATH\@/, "NULL"));
} else
of.WriteLine(ln);
}
ofi.Close();
of.Close();
}
/* Configures libexslt. This one will generate exsltconfig.h from exsltconfig.h.in
taking what the user passed on the command line into account. */
function configureExslt()
{
var fso, ofi, of, ln, s;
fso = new ActiveXObject("Scripting.FileSystemObject");
ofi = fso.OpenTextFile(optsFileInExslt, 1);
of = fso.CreateTextFile(optsFileExslt, true);
while (ofi.AtEndOfStream != true) {
ln = ofi.ReadLine();
s = new String(ln);
if (s.search(/\@VERSION\@/) != -1) {
of.WriteLine(s.replace(/\@VERSION\@/,
verMajorExslt + "." + verMinorExslt + "." + verMicroExslt));
} else if (s.search(/\@LIBEXSLT_VERSION_NUMBER\@/) != -1) {
of.WriteLine(s.replace(/\@LIBEXSLT_VERSION_NUMBER\@/,
verMajorExslt*10000 + verMinorExslt*100 + verMicroExslt*1));
} else if (s.search(/\@LIBEXSLT_VERSION_EXTRA\@/) != -1) {
of.WriteLine(s.replace(/\@LIBEXSLT_VERSION_EXTRA\@/, verCvs));
} else if (s.search(/\@WITH_CRYPTO\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_CRYPTO\@/, withCrypto? "1" : "0"));
} else if (s.search(/\@WITH_MODULES\@/) != -1) {
of.WriteLine(s.replace(/\@WITH_MODULES\@/, withModules? "1" : "0"));
} else
of.WriteLine(ln);
}
ofi.Close();
of.Close();
}
